The watch Siddaramaiah sports has become the talk of the town after JD(S) state president H D Kumaraswamy took a jibe at his socialist credentials, saying the timepiece costs Rs 70 lakh.
In the early 1980s, a Rolex owned by Chand Mahal Ibrahim, deputy chairman of the state planning board, became an issue on the floor of the House. As a minister in the R Gundu Rao cabinet, he was gifted a Rolex by a UAE minister.
Its value exceeded the price limit permitted under the FCRA, prompting fomer MLC AK Subbaiah to raise the issue. While Kumaraswamy has turned down Siddaramaiah’s offer to buy his watch saying “he is not a scrap dealer”, the timepiece continues to generate a debate.
